The document discusses the digitization workflow and use of a metadata editor tool in the Moravian library. The tool is used to import scanned documents, create and edit structural and bibliographic metadata, generate identifiers, and publish documents in the Kramerius digital library. The metadata editor allows library staff to check pagination, split documents into chapters or articles, and set page types. However, the old Czech standard the library uses has limitations and does not fully support describing all document types like maps. A new version of Kramerius and the metadata editor are being developed to address these issues.
